Exegesis
The causal conjunction dioti {διότι | dió-ti} ‘because’ introduces the reason clause, where the negative particle ou {οὐ | ou} negates paradexontai {παραδέξονταί | pa-ra-dé-xon-tai} ‘they will accept.’

In context — Acts 22:18
And I saw Him say to me, “Act quickly and leave Jerusalem at once, because they will not receive your testimony about Me.”
